Theater review: 'Late: A Cowboy Song' staged with bluesy whimsy by Nelson Pressley

"Late: A Cowboy Song" is an early work by Sarah Ruhl, now well-established through "The Clean House" and "Dead Man's Cell Phone" and a MacArthur "genius" grant as one of the country's top playwrights. It's a loping, poetic little three-character doodle about a man and his wife " mainly his wife, for the husband's a dud and the woman, lost and lonely, is mysteriously drawn toward a lady cowboy on the outskirts of Pitt…
